Curry Chicken Nasih Lemak
Malaysian style curry chicken with coconut rice, served with sambal ikan bilis, 1/2 sliced egg, salad and a papadom. Authentic taste! The curry is a little spicy (just perfect) and the sambal is pretty spicy! Get some water ready  :shocked: Love those papadoms!
